Taxonomic Classification
| Rank | Große Somali-Rennmaus | Schwarzfrüchtige Zwergmispel |
|---|---|---|
| Kingdom | Animalia (Tier) | Plantae (Pflanzen) |
| Phylum | Chordata (Chordatiere) | Magnoliophyta (Flowering Plants) |
| Class | Mammalia (Säugetiere) | Magnoliopsida (Dicots) |
| Order | Rodentia (Nagetiere) | Rosales (Rosenartige) |
| Family | Muridae (Mice & Rats) | Rosaceae (Rose Family) |
| Genus | Ammodillus | Cotoneaster |
| Species | Ammodillus imbellis | Cotoneaster laxiflorus |
